When you're starting a painting project, it might be tempting to assume all paint is created equal. But there’s a major distinction between interior and exterior paint — and using the wrong one can lead to cracking, peeling, fading, or even health risks.
In this FAQ blog, we’ll break down the key differences and help you choose the right paint for your project.
1. Ingredients and Formulation
Interior Paint:
Formulated for low- to no-VOC (Volatile Organic Compounds) to reduce indoor fumes
Designed for smooth application, easy cleanup, and minimal odour
Focuses on durability against scuffs and stains
Exterior Paint:
Contains additives to resist UV rays, mildew, rain, snow, and temperature swings
Stronger smell due to higher VOCs (ventilation required)
Formulated for maximum adhesion and flexibility on surfaces like wood, vinyl, or masonry
Bottom line: Interior paint prioritizes safety and indoor durability, while exterior paint is built to withstand nature’s elements.
2. Durability and Resistance
Interior Paint:
Resists marks, cleaning, and indoor wear and tear
Not built to handle intense sun or rain exposure
Exterior Paint:
Formulated to resist fading, chalking, cracking, and mildew
Flexible in extreme hot/cold to prevent flaking or peeling
🚫 Don’t use interior paint outside — it won’t last.
🚫 Don’t use exterior paint indoors — it may contain unsafe additives and strong fumes.
3. Surface Compatibility
Interior Paint:
Ideal for drywall, trim, ceilings, and indoor wood
Available in a wide variety of finishes like matte, eggshell, satin, and gloss
Exterior Paint:
Bonds to wood, brick, stucco, vinyl, concrete, aluminum, and more
Often includes UV-protective pigments to slow fading
4. Finishes and Colour Retention
Interior paint holds colour well indoors and offers a broader selection of designer finishes
Exterior paint is optimized for colour retention outdoors, especially against fading from the sun
For long-lasting results, always use the correct type for your surface and location.
